So here's my take on PDA Pro for Demand Avoidance. I've tested a bunch of parenting apps and this one's pretty solid. The tailored advice and personalized support are the best features - you can get insights specific to your child's needs. I also like the community aspect, it's nice to connect with other parents going through similar challenges. On the downside, the content library can feel a bit overwhelming at times, and the advice isn't always as detailed as I'd like. But overall, it's a really helpful app if you're parenting a child with Pathological Demand Avoidance.

Description

I’ve been using PDA Pro for Demand Avoidance for a couple months now. It’s basically an app that gives you personalized support and guidance for parents dealing with Pathological Demand Avoidance. Pretty solid if you’re a parent of a PDA kid.

Here’s what you can do – there’s a big library of articles and videos with insights on PDA. You can also get tailored advice based on your specific situation. It’s got a cool feature where you can record your challenges and get custom recommendations. And there’s a community forum to connect with other PDA parents, which is really helpful.

Look, navigating life with a PDA child isn’t easy, but this app can make it a bit less stressful. It’s not perfect – sometimes the advice feels a little generic – but overall it does the job. Worth checking out if you’re dealing with PDA.
